The cheapest way to get from Rusinga Island to Nairobi Airport (NBO) is to bus which costs $8 - $13 and takes 7h 50m.
The fastest way to get from Rusinga Island to Nairobi Airport (NBO) is to ferry and drive and fly which takes 3h 34m and costs $85 - $210.
No, there is no direct bus from Rusinga Island to Nairobi Airport (NBO). However, there are services departing from Mbita and arriving at JKIA - Passenger Boarding via Easy Coach/Uchumi and Cabanas.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 7h 50m.
The distance between Rusinga Island and Nairobi Airport (NBO) is 370 km. The road distance is 411.1 km.
The best way to get from Rusinga Island to Nairobi Airport (NBO) without a car is to bus which takes 7h 50m and costs $8 - $13.
It takes approximately 3h 34m to get from Rusinga Island to Nairobi Airport (NBO), including transfers.
Rusinga Island to Nairobi Airport (NBO) bus services, operated by The Guardian Coach, depart from Mbita station.
Rusinga Island to Nairobi Airport (NBO) bus services, operated by The Guardian Coach, arrive at Nairobi station.
Yes, the driving distance between Rusinga Island to Nairobi Airport (NBO) is 411 km. It takes approximately 6h 18m to drive from Rusinga Island to Nairobi Airport (NBO).
